3

Это полная противоположность тому, есть ли Firefox-подобный контейнер плагинов для Chrome.

С моими 100+ вкладками, открытыми в FF, есть две с половиной альтернативы:

  • использовать плагин-контейнер и заставить его съедать процессор, память и зависать всю систему (не говорите мне о BFS)
  • выключите его, и браузер будет зависать каждый раз, когда происходит сбой Flash.
  • Белый список NoScript, который раздражает.

Таким образом, кажется разумным спросить, есть ли модификация / ветка Firefox, которая имеет поддержку мультипроцесс / песочница, готовая для запуска каждого экземпляра плагина (для вкладки) в песочнице? Было множество таких слухов, включая http://news.slashdot.org/story/12/02/06/2147219/sandboxed-flash-player-coming-to-firefox

2 ответа2

1

Попробуйте использовать надстройку BarTab Lite. Это затемняет ваши неактивные вкладки, заставляя FF использовать часть памяти. Содержимое вкладок (и плагины для этих вкладок) загружаются только при нажатии (активации) вкладки.

У меня есть сотни вкладок, но только 5-20, которые я открыл во время любого конкретного сеанса, используют системные ресурсы, благодаря BarTab Lite.

1

Существует официальный проект Mozilla под названием "электролиз", который посвящен восстановлению FF, так что каждая вкладка выполняется в одном процессе. Идея и цели описаны здесь:

http://blog.mozilla.org/products/2011/07/15/goals-for-multi-process-firefox/

Подобное восстановление FF - это огромное усилие, потому что так много нужно фундаментально изменить. У Mozilla были и другие идеи, чтобы было проще улучшить время отклика Firefox. Вот почему проект электролиза был заморожен.

http://lawrencemandel.com/2011/11/15/update-on-multi-process-firefox-electrolysis-development/

Я думаю, что текущие версии FF уже включают некоторые из этих других улучшений. Не знаю, завершены ли они. AFAIK проект электролиза все еще заморожен.

click_to_play может быть альтернативой noscript: http://www.h-online.com/open/news/item/Firefox-14-introduces-HTTPS-search-by-default-Update-1644075.html

И это касается текущих улучшений в распределении памяти в FF для плагинов и песочниц: http://www.h-online.com/open/news/item/Firefox-15-reduces-memory-consump-1649125.html

PS: я хотел бы добавить, что ИМХО запуск многих процессов будет занимать много памяти. Иногда есть способы уменьшить это потребление, но они не всегда применимы. Я не знаю об общем потреблении памяти, но Chromium, по крайней мере, потребляет гораздо больше места подкачки, чем Firefox в моей системе Linux.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.